Taylor Numbers for the Fast Multipole Method

preprint OA: closed
View at publisher

Abstract

We present a novel linear algebra formulation of the math behind the FastMultipole Method (FMM). For this, we introduce the Taylor numbers. They are polynomials governed by differential algebra but used like integers and floating points. They help simplify the FMM math and potentially any scientific programming project.
